SAFe® Product Owner/Product Manager with POPM Certification Training Course
Develop the necessary skillsets to lead the delivery of value in a Lean enterprise and learn about the activities, tools, and methods used to manage backlogs and programs by becoming a SAFe® 4 Product Owner/Product Manager (POPM). Over this two-day course, participants will gain a deep understanding of the Agile Release Train (ART), how it delivers value, and the actions they can take to effectively perform their role.
They will also learn how to apply Lean thinking to write Epics, break them down into Features and Stories, plan and execute Iterations, and plan Program Increments. Additionally, participants will explore the Continuous Delivery Pipeline and DevOps culture, understand how to integrate effectively as Product Owners and Product Managers, and discover what it takes to continuously improve the ART.
To successfully perform the role of a SAFe® Product Owner/Product Manager, attendees should be able to:
- Apply SAFe principles in a Lean enterprise
- Align SAFe Lean-Agile principles and values with the PO/PM roles
- Collaborate with Lean Portfolio Management
- Engage in continuous value delivery through Program Increment Planning
- Execute the Program Increment to ensure continuous value delivery
- Clearly articulate the responsibilities of Product Owners and Product Managers
- Create a detailed action plan for their role

This course is available as onsite live training in Uzbekistan or online live training.Course Outline
- Applying SAFe in a Lean enterprise
- Relating Lean-Agile thinking to the roles of Product Owner and Product Manager
- Collaborating with Lean Portfolio Management
- Continuous discovery of customer needs
- Executing Program Increments
- Defining the roles and responsibilities of Product Owner/Product Manager
- Creating an action plan for the Product Owner/Product Manager role
Requirements
All are welcome to attend the course, regardless of experience. However, the following prerequisites are strongly recommended for those who intend to take the SAFe® 4 Product Owner/Product Manager (POPM) certification exam:
- Participation in the Leading SAFe® course
- Experience working in a SAFe environment
- Experience with Lean, Agile, or other relevant certifications
